Arsenal 2-1 Everton

The fact that the Arsenal fans were calling for full time, ten minutes left, and that Arsenal tried to keep the ball near the corner flag shows that Everton played well and were unlucky not to receive something from the game.

Eight minutes into his 26th appearance for the Gunners, Cygan stole ahead of a static Everton defence to power a header beyond Richard Wright from Thierry Henry's wickedly delivered corner.

The goal brought the confidence Arsenal were in need of.

It was Richard Wrights first return to Highbury since his departure...Wright spilled a routine Dennis Bergkamp shot into the path of Henry and was grateful to Alan Stubbs for his timely block.

The always lively, Thierry Henry went close with a fierce volley after flicking the ball up to create his own opportunity.

The first 30 minutes were Evertons worst period of the game.


Wayne Rooney looked dangerous every time he got the ball, in-front of an impressed England manager.

Early in the second half, Rooney set up strike partner Kevin Campbell for a shot into the side netting, but the young striker finally took matters into his own hands on 56 minutes...

Picking up a pass from Campbell, Rooney ran straight at the Arsenal defence, Cygan backed off, resulting in Rooney to crack a low shot between the defender's legs and beyond Stuart Taylor into the far corner of the Arsenal net, to add to his tally of wonder goals!.

The buzz only lasted 8 minutes.

Everton were furious that David Unsworth was not awarded a free-kick as he tangled with Bergkamp resulting in Vieira to slam home the decisive goal.
